How To Fix OA226 - SAP ArchiveLink (runtime, object number not completely qualified)


OA226 - Overview

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: OA - SAP ArchiveLink: Messages for SAP ArchiveLink

  • Message number: 226

  • Message text: SAP ArchiveLink (runtime, object number not completely qualified)

    The SAP error message OA226, which states "SAP ArchiveLink (runtime, object number not completely qualified)," typically occurs when there is an issue with the object number being used in the ArchiveLink system. This error indicates that the object number provided is not fully qualified, meaning it lacks the necessary details to identify the document or object in the ArchiveLink system.
    
    Cause: Incomplete Object Number: The object number provided does not include all the required components. In ArchiveLink, an object number usually consists of multiple parts that uniquely identify a document. Incorrect Configuration: The ArchiveLink configuration may not be set up correctly, leading to issues in how object numbers are processed. Missing Metadata: The metadata associated with the document may be incomplete or missing, which can prevent the system from recognizing the object number. Data Corruption: There may be corruption in the data or the database that is causing the object number to be misinterpreted.
